SHIRTS

Relaxed Fit
The relaxed fit is a longer length shirt with gently sloping shoulders, a soft collar, and wide hems. It is a flowy style and is usually paired with softer materials.

Boxy Fit
The boxy fit is a shorter length, with drop shoulders, a wide collar and short sleeves. Often paired with stronger materials, it holds its shape on the body and is an expressive overshirt.

PANTS

A note on the pants:
We have two types of pants, single-pleat and double pleat. 
The single-pleat pants has one pleat in the back, making it suitable for people with narrower hips. The double-pleat pants have, you guessed it, two pleats in the back which give more room for people with a bit of extra tush. The pants are blindhemmed so that the length can be easily adjusted.

Both pants are high waisted with a simple elegant silhouette.
